Topic: Problem while using Fmt function
Replies: 5
Views: 2382

Add in an extra little part (Iconv(DSLink3.Field001,"MCN"):

Ans = If DSLink3.Field001[1,1]="-" Then "-":Fmt(Iconv(DSLink3.Field001,"MCN"),'18"0"R5') Else Fmt(DSLink3.Field001,'18"0"R5')

Topic: change list of servers to use when starting Designer/Directo
Replies: 8
Views: 3214

I know this is an old post, but I came across it after having the same minor problem as Peter. I found I could simply highlight the entry in the host system drop down list, then delete it. It is then permanently removed from the list. Deleting entries from the registry did not work for me.
